1. An apparatus for application of surgical clips to body tissue, the apparatus comprising:

  • a handle assembly;

    a shaft assembly including a housing extending distally from the handle assembly and defining a longitudinal axis, the housing includes a fixed boss provided therein;

    a plurality of surgical clips disposed within the shaft assembly;

    a jaw mounted adjacent a distal end portion of the shaft assembly, the jaw being movable between an open spaced-apart condition and a closed approximated condition;

    a pusher bar reciprocally disposed within the housing of the shaft assembly and being detachably connectable to the boss of the housing of the shaft assembly, the pusher bar being configured to load a distal-most surgical clip into the jaws during distal movement and remain connected to the boss of the housing of the shaft assembly and in a distally advanced position during an approximation of the jaws;

    a connector plate reciprocally disposed within the shaft assembly, wherein the connector plate is detachably connectable to the pusher bar, wherein during an initial distal movement of the connector plate the pusher bar is distally advanced and during a further distal movement of the connector plate the connector plate is disconnected from the pusher bar;

    an advancer plate reciprocally disposed within the shaft assembly, the advancer plate including at least one fin detachably connectable to a shoulder of the pusher bar, wherein the shoulder of the pusher bar engages the at least one fin of the advancer plate during a distal and a proximal movement of the pusher bar to effectuate at least one of a distal and proximal movement of the advancer plate; and

    a clip follower slidably supported in the shaft assembly for urging the plurality of surgical clips in a distal direction, the clip follower including a first tab projecting from a first surface thereof and a second tab projecting from a second surface thereof, wherein the first tab of the clip follower engages the advancer plate as the advancer plate is moved distally such that the clip follower is moved distally to advance the plurality of surgical clips, and wherein the second tab of the clip follower engages a feature as the advancer plate is moved proximally such that the clip follower remains stationary.
